Transaction d3324aa7b85d607735b88a9b1eb24ed5f540d84fa7a0de83067f4d74e27033a6
1 Input
1 Output
-
d3324aa7b85d607735b88a9b1eb24ed5f540d84fa7a0de83067f4d74e27033a6:0
- value
- 586476
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cab51e6485b8beac3dee8fe2ba4cdc25c29739fe OP_EQUAL
- address
- 3LAqPeEtZDQyvkzm3yNwPGYCF769BQQFBs